What Is Rotel Dip?

Think of Rotel Dip as nacho cheese’s quirky cousin. It’s a creamy, cheesy dip made with just a few ingredients: Velveeta cheese, Rotel tomatoes (aka tomatoes with a spicy attitude), and optional ground beef or sausage if you want it to have a little more “meat-ing.”

When you mix all these goodies together, you get a dip that’s warm, gooey, and spicy enough to make your taste buds do a happy dance. The best part? It takes about as much time to make as it does to realize you’re on your third helping.

Ingredients for the Ultimate Rotel Dip Recipe

Let’s break it down into what you need for this dip to be the life of the party (or at least the snack table):

  1. Velveeta Cheese – The glue that holds this whole party together. It melts smoothly into a creamy, cheesy pool of happiness. Plus, it’s so smooth it could get you out of a traffic ticket.
  2. Rotel Tomatoes – These are diced tomatoes with green chilies that bring a little bit of zing and a whole lot of “zing-a-ling” to the party. Mild, medium, or hot—you get to choose your spice level.
  3. Ground Beef or Sausage (optional) – Want to take your dip to a more filling, heartier level? Throw in some cooked ground beef or sausage. It’s like giving your dip a little bodybuilding boost.

How to Make Rotel Dip

Ready to transform these ingredients into something magical? Here’s the ridiculously easy step-by-step guide:

  1. Cook the Meat: Start by browning your ground beef or sausage in a skillet over medium heat. Stir it up until it’s cooked through and there’s no pink left. Drain the grease, unless you’re into that kind of thing.
  2. Melt the Cheese: Slice the Velveeta into cubes to help it melt faster. (Yes, cubes are faster—don’t ask why, it’s kitchen physics.) Throw those cheese cubes into a large saucepan with your can of Rotel tomatoes—juice and all! The juice is like a little gift of extra flavor.
  3. Combine and Heat: Add the cooked meat to your cheesy-tomatoey mix. Stir everything together over low heat until it’s melted and smooth. Or, if you’re feeling wild, toss it all in the microwave, heating it in one-minute intervals and stirring each time. Just don’t walk away—nobody likes scorched cheese.
  4. Serve and Devour: Pour your Rotel Dip into a bowl or a mini crockpot if you’re fancy and want it warm throughout the night. Surround it with chips, crackers, veggies, or whatever you think might be good covered in cheese (spoiler: everything is better covered in cheese).

Tips for the Best Rotel Dip Recipe

  • Turn Up the Heat: Feeling spicy? Use hot Rotel tomatoes or toss in a few jalapeños. Just remember: with great spice comes great responsibility.
  • Slow Cooker Hack: For parties, keeping this in a slow cooker on the “warm” setting makes it easy for people to dip without it turning into a cold blob. (Or, as I like to call it, the Blob That Cheese Forgot).
  • Dress It Up: Try toppings like green onions, fresh tomatoes, or a dollop of sour cream for extra pizzazz. Rotel Dip is all about personality, so go wild!
